  • Patent number: 4960344
    Abstract: A locking mechanism for fixing an outer part (5) on an inner part (4) having locking members (8) which are guided in apertures (7) of the outer part so as to be radially movable in a limited way. In the locking position, these locking members (8) are supported radially outwardly on a locking ring (10). A control ring (16) retains the locking ring in the open position. For this purpose, the control ring (16) is displaced eccentrically and is supported on a stop (19) associated with the outer part (5). By inserting the inner part (4), the control ring (16) is aligned coaxially by the control members (8) so that a spring (12) loading the locking ring (10) can act to move the control ring (16) across the stop (19) so that the locking position is achieved.

  • Patent number: 4957387
    Abstract: A spline joint includes an externally splined shaft end and an internally splined hub end engaged therewith. The shaft end has an annular groove around the spline portion wherein a plurality of locking balls may ride. The hub has the same number of holes as there are locking balls, each of which hole is adapted to receive a locking ball. A sliding sheath surrounds the hub. This sliding sheath has an annular projection and an annular groove in axially spaced relation around its internal face. The annular projection presses against the locking balls when the spline joint is in operation. The annular groove embraces a polygonal spring, the spring having the same number of sides as the number of locking balls. The center of each side of the polygonal spring presses against a lock ball from a radially outward position and prevents the lock balls from going out of position when the spline joint is being detached.

  • Patent number: 4955741
    Abstract: A universal joint includes a pair of yokes each having two trunnions projecting radially thereof, and an annular intermediate ring having bearings arranged on two diametrical lines thereof intersecting each other at right angles for supporting the respective trunnions. An annular central cover having a spherical outer surface is fixedly intimately fitted around the intermediate ring. Between the ring and a connecting flange at the outer end of each yoke, a collar is formed on the yoke. A pair of annular side covers each having a spherical inner surface slidable in contact with the spherical outer surface of the central cover each have an outer end portion horizontal in section and fixed to the periphery of the collar. An annular seal member in intimate contact with the outer surface of the central cover is provided at the inner end portion of each side cover. A clearance required for the sliding movement of the side covers is formed between the inner ends of the side covers.

  • Patent number: 4953899
    Abstract: An improved clamp assembly for clamping the overlapping ends of metal tubes in an exhaust system. The clamp assembly includes a metal ring having a pair of overlapping end portions disposed in side-by-side contact. A generally U-shaped bracket is secured to each of the end portions and each bracket has a pair of opposed legs connected by a web portion. Extensions project longitudinally outward from the end of each leg and the extensions are offset laterally from each other. One leg of each bracket is welded to one of the end portions of the ring and the welded leg is bent adjacent the weld to position the first extension in slidable contact with the other end portion of the ring. The extension of the opposite leg is disposed in side-by-side relation with the first extension and also serves to slidably receive the opposite end portion of the ring.
